Corymbia ficifolia 'Mini Red'

Grafted onto dwarfing rootstock, this small growing tree has all the attributes of a full sized Corymbia ficifolia in a smaller sized tree. Bird attracting bright red flowers from December to March, and the grafting guarantees flower colour. Foliage has a weeping habit with a canopy covered with flowers.  Nectar eating birds find this irresistable.  Hardy in all well drained soil types protect from frost while young.  Drought hardy once established. Grows 2-3m high x 2m wide. 16" pot size.

Solenostemon scutellarioides 

Coleus Campfire produces glowing orange foliage which makes this beauty a real Winner. Performs best in full sunlight or shade, retaining its colour in either. This is a vigorous choice that will not disappoint. Coleus is known for their wide colour range and ease of care it is hard not to love them. The intense colour range will add a little excitement wherever you plant them. They are great to mix and match in either a pot or garden. The best foliage colour is produced with good light. Water to establish then keep moist in active growth. 6" pot size.

Acmena smithii minor 'Ruby Tips

A larger dense shrub with a pretty display of small green leaves and colourful pink/ red-bronze new growth which bears fluffy cream flowers followed by berries. Resistant to pysllid and most other pests and diseases. Height 3-4m 6'' pot size.

Trachelospermum jasminoides

A gorgeous, evergreen climber trained in the sculptural art of espalier • Fragrant white jasmine flowers in summer • Perfect for covering unsightly walls or fences • Can be grown in pots or made into living wall art
